What are some misconceptions about synchronized swimming as a performance art?

Common misconceptions about synchronized swimming include the idea that it is merely a recreational activity rather than a serious art form or sport. Some believe it's restricted to specific age groups or lacks diversity in participants, but it actually requires significant physical skill, artistic creativity, and perseverance, appealing to a wide range of athletes worldwide.
